Understanding the Role of the Prime Minister

Before we delve into the specifics of the Prime Minister’s salary, it is essential to understand the role they play in the Indian government. The Prime Minister is the head of government in India and is responsible for overseeing the administration of the country. They are appointed by the President of India and are typically the leader of the political party that has the most seats in the Lok Sabha, the lower house of the Indian Parliament.

The Prime Minister’s Responsibilities

The Prime Minister of India has a wide range of responsibilities, including:

  1. Formulating and implementing government policies
  2. Representing India on the national and international stage
  3. Leading the Council of Ministers
  4. Advising the President on key issues
